Christmas Tree Biscuits

Ingredients

  • 150 g butter, softened
  • 225 g brown sugar
  • 2 eggs, lightly beaten
  • 350 g plain fl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 4 teaspoons mixed spice, ground

Instructions

  1. Combine the butter and sugar.
  2. Slowly add the eggs and beat until the mixture is smooth.
  3. Stir in the flour, baking powder and spice and mix thoroughly.
  4. Cover and chill for about 1 hour minimum.
  5. Preheat oven to 180 C / 350 F / Gas 4.
  6. Carefully roll out the mixture on a floured surface and using Christmas biscuit cutters, cut out various shapes.
  7. Using a skewer, make holes at the top of the shape to thread ribbons through.
  8. Place on greased baking sheets and bake for about 10 minutes.
  9. Cool on a wire rack.
  10. When cool, thread with Christmas ribbons, decorate with icing and hang on your Christmas tree.
